abstract

  • An approximate skew incidence diffraction coefficient is presented for an arbitrary impedance wedge configuration. The derivation of the diffraction coefficient is based on the available UTD (universal theory of diffraction) coefficients for an impedance half-plane. These are rearranged in a form allowing the identification and modification of terms as applied to the wedge. The new diffraction coefficient is then constructed, recovering the normal incidence impedance wedge solution.
